Transaction 327c615d97ea991f17cfeff2d6f4c3ee951c1a900139a88860e19db98c565403
1 Input
1 Output
-
327c615d97ea991f17cfeff2d6f4c3ee951c1a900139a88860e19db98c565403:0
- value
- 530073
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95c76bef8953c896134190e7c93286185924b64c OP_EQUAL
- address
- 3FLyWBcd9Cy3Am2Kiz4wUj6c6QDzRgJSWw